Team,

The Orbit Rewards programme is underperforming. Redemption rates at Keldon Retail sit below 12%, and enrolment has stalled across the Varnmouth region. Proposal: collapse the three-tier structure into a single points model, sunset legacy vouchers by Q3, and shift funding toward the Brightline partner network. Marlo Fenwick's team has costed the transition; payback inside fourteen months. We need board sign-off before the Hallowell summit. Full commercial detail is set out in the confidential note below.

management briefing: Istaelix Group is in early talks to buy Sorysax Logistics for about $496.2 million. The Kasox launch date is October 3, and nothing goes to the press before then. Legal wants the Norokax Foods term sheet withdrawn before April 25.

Handover note — Crumbwheel order cutoffs.

Welcome aboard. The bakery cutoff rule in Crumbwheel closes same-day orders at 14:00 local to each storefront, not UTC — this has bitten us twice. Holiday overrides live in the calendar service and take precedence silently, so always check there first when a cutoff looks wrong. To unlock the calendar service's admin console after a restart, enter the recovery passphrase below.

vault phrase of bagap-bahaf = silion-pelox-sorox-casdor-quenwyn-fraax-eliox-praael-kelion-quenvan-kasox-rusael-norius-belvan

The Tallyfox loyalty-points ledger exposes a pretty simple surface: POST /points to credit or debit, GET /balance for the current total, and GET /history for the last 90 days of entries. Plugin authors should note that debits exceeding the available balance return a 409 rather than going negative — handle that gracefully instead of retrying blindly. Rate limits sit at 60 requests per minute per plugin. Authenticate every request with the bearer token below.

portal login ticket: eyJhbGciOiJIUzI1NiIsInR5cCI6IkpXVCJ9.eyJzdWIiOiIMjvRAf3PEFIn0.nuv9gjixLtnr